China's regulatory environment is changing almost every day in the preparation of making its regulatory commitments to comply with the international rules and standards currently subscribed to by the major international economic organization and major world trading countries.
China will make significant, even radical changes in the laws and policies in certain industries currently restricted or prohibited to foreign investors, such as the telecommunications, internet information services, financial services, medical services, foreign trade, media, advertising, retailing to name but a few.
